Common Integration Use Cases Between MediaValet and OpenText Webroot Unity

MediaValet and OpenText Webroot Unity serve different but complementary enterprise needs: MediaValet manages and distributes high-value digital assets, while OpenText Webroot Unity protects endpoints and helps secure the devices used to create, access, and share those assets. Integrating them can strengthen governance, reduce operational risk, and improve collaboration across marketing, creative, IT, and security teams.

1. Secure access to brand assets from protected endpoints

Data flow: OpenText Webroot Unity to MediaValet

Use endpoint security posture from OpenText Webroot Unity to control or condition access to MediaValet for employees and contractors. For example, if a device is flagged for malware, ransomware, or phishing risk, access to sensitive brand libraries can be restricted until the endpoint is remediated.

  • Prevents compromised devices from downloading or sharing confidential assets
  • Reduces risk of brand leaks and unauthorized distribution
  • Supports security policies for remote workers and external agencies

2. Alert security teams when sensitive assets are accessed from high-risk devices

Data flow: MediaValet to OpenText Webroot Unity

When MediaValet detects access to restricted folders, approved campaign assets, or regulated content, it can send activity details to OpenText Webroot Unity for correlation with endpoint risk signals. Security teams can then investigate whether the access came from a suspicious or noncompliant device.

  • Improves visibility into who accessed what and from where
  • Helps identify potential insider risk or compromised credentials
  • Supports audit and compliance investigations

3. Quarantine or block endpoints after suspicious asset-sharing activity

Data flow: MediaValet to OpenText Webroot Unity

If MediaValet detects unusual download volume, repeated failed access attempts, or sharing of restricted assets outside approved groups, that event can trigger a security workflow in OpenText Webroot Unity. The endpoint can be flagged for deeper inspection, isolation, or additional threat scanning.

  • Responds quickly to abnormal behavior involving valuable content
  • Limits the chance of mass asset exfiltration
  • Connects content governance with endpoint response
